A Quest Case Study
Philadelphia Youth Network (PYN) is a Philadelphia nonprofit that connects young people with jobs and career-preparation opportunities. PYN needed to merge and clean data from diverse sources (Oracle, SQL Server, MySQL and partner files) to identify low‑socioeconomic neighborhoods for outreach and to support financial planning, invoicing and donor relations. Manual, time‑intensive data work—especially during the busy summer WorkReady program—strained staff and pulled resources away from frontline services.
By deploying Toad Data Point to automate workflows, centralize reporting and improve data quality, PYN built repeatable processes that run automatically, freeing the equivalent of 1–2 full‑time employees and saving the CIO about 25% of his busiest workweek. The solution enabled accurate forecasting of finances, enrollment and recruitment, faster identification of target youth, SMS alerts that keep social workers in the field, and an overall shift to data‑driven decision making.
